Florida Electricity Prices Surge 13% Amid Rising Demand

Story summary
  • Florida electricity prices rose more than 13% in the past year, driven by residential demand and AI data centers.
  • Drew Maloney of the Edison Electric Institute said more households switching to electric vehicles and appliances will push demand higher.
  • The Energy Department projects electricity demand will grow 2.2% this year.
  • Kathy Letourneau, a Florida resident, said her monthly bills range from $200 to $300 on a fixed income.
